ネットワーク・インフラ・クラウド– category –
-
ネットワーク・インフラ・クラウド
MQTT — IoTを支える軽量Publish/Subscribeプロトコル
MQTT(Message Queuing Telemetry Transport)は、Pub/Sub型のメッセージ配信プロトコルです。1999年にIBMのAndy Stanford-Clark氏とCirrus LinkのArlen Nipper氏が、石油パイプラインの監視用に低帯域・低消費電力を狙って設計しました。ヘッダがわずか2... -
ネットワーク・インフラ・クラウド
Consul — サービス発見と鍵値ストアを束ねる基盤
Consulは2014年4月にHashiCorp社が公開したOSSのプロダクトで、サービス発見・ヘルスチェック・鍵値ストア・そしてサービスメッシュ機能(Consul Connect)を1つのバイナリで提供します。HashiCorp社の共同創業者ミッチェル・ハシモト氏とアーマン・ダドガ... -
ネットワーク・インフラ・クラウド
Linkerd — シンプル軽量を貫く初代サービスメッシュ
Linkerdは2015年9月にBuoyant社が公開した、世界初のサービスメッシュとして知られるOSSプロダクトです。Buoyant社の共同創業者ウィリアム・モーガン氏とオリバー・グールド氏はいずれもTwitter出身で、Twitter社内で開発されていたFinagleというScala製RP... -
ネットワーク・インフラ・クラウド
Envoy — 現代マイクロサービスを束ねるL7プロキシ
Envoyは2016年にライドシェア大手のLyft社で開発が始まり、2017年9月にオープンソースとして公開された高性能なL7プロキシです。設計を主導したのはLyftのエンジニアであるマット・クライン氏で、HTTP/2・gRPC・WebSocketといった現代的プロトコルをファー... -
ネットワーク・インフラ・クラウド
Calico — BGPで実ネットワークと一体化するCNI
CalicoはKubernetesやOpenStack向けのオープンソースなネットワーキング基盤で、BGP(Border Gateway Protocol)を使ってPodのIPを物理ネットワークと素直に統合する点が個性です。2014年に英国のMetaswitch Networks内で生まれ、後にプロジェクトを引き継... -
ネットワーク・インフラ・クラウド
Cilium — eBPFで描く高速なKubernetesネットワーク
Ciliumは2017年に登場したOSSのCNI実装で、Linuxカーネル機能のeBPFを徹底活用してKubernetesのネットワーク・セキュリティ・ロードバランシングを一括で担います。開発元はIsovalent社で、創業者であるトーマス・グラフ氏は元Red Hatのカーネルネットワー... -
ネットワーク・インフラ・クラウド
Ingress-NGINX — Kubernetes公式のNginx製L7ゲートウェイ
Ingress-NGINXはKubernetes公式(kubernetes/ingress-nginxリポジトリ)が開発するIngressコントローラで、Webサーバーとして長い実績を持つNginxをデータプレーンに据えています。2016年頃にプロジェクトとして整備が始まり、現在はKubernetes SIG-Networ... -
ネットワーク・インフラ・クラウド
kube-proxy — Service宛通信を実Podへ振り分ける部品
kube-proxyはKubernetesクラスタの各ノードで動く軽量なネットワーク部品で、ClusterIPやNodePortといったServiceに届いた通信を、実際のPod群に振り分ける役割を担います。2014年のKubernetes初期から存在する古参コンポーネントで、Go言語で実装されDaem... -
ネットワーク・インフラ・クラウド
kubectl — Kubernetes操作の窓口となる公式CLI
kubectlはKubernetesクラスタをコマンドラインから操作するための公式CLIで、「キューブコントロール」または「キューブカトル」と呼ばれます。2014年6月のKubernetes初公開時から付属しており、クラスタ管理者・開発者が日常的に最も多く触れるツールです... -
ネットワーク・インフラ・クラウド
kubelet — 各ノードでPodを駆動させる現場監督
kubeletはKubernetesクラスタを構成する各ノード(仮想マシンや物理サーバー)に常駐するエージェントで、コントロールプレーンから受け取ったPodSpecの通りにコンテナを起動・監視するのが役目です。2014年にGoogleがKubernetesをオープンソース化した際...
